33674200859246720 is an even composite number. It is composed of four dist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of three hundred eighty-four divisors.

Prime factorization of 33674200859246720:

27 × 5 × 435 × 713

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 5 × 43 × 43 × 43 × 43 × 43 × 71 × 71 × 71)
